Publisher's Summary

A Necromancer on the run. Tyron Steelarm, accompanied by the spirit of his mentor and friend, Dove, is desperate to realise his potential and change his destiny. To achieve his aims, he must outwit and outrun the marshals who seek to track him down, and the slayers who want him dead.

Worst of all, his own parents, renowned heroes of the realm, have been tasked with bringing him to justice. For how long will they be able to delay fulfilling this cruel order, and what will happen when they run out of time?All Tyron can do is run, and fight.

Book 2 of the next hit LitRPG series from RinoZ, the author of Chrysalis. Book of the Dead takes on all aspects of Necromancy headfirst, from the tactical manuevering of skeletons, to what it's like spending so much time amongst the undead.

Well done

Firstly, the production rate of this author is insane. I wish I could have the oportunity to pick his (or her) brain about their process for writing stories.

The quality of this book is high and with no added fluff--every hour of this book is the meat and potatos of what you really want to hear (/read).

The character growth is phenomenal as well. But more than just whats offered in this book, the tragectory of the MCs character growth for the next book is perhaps whats most exciting to me.

You can tell this author knows exactly what he's doing with his characters--everything from the overarching story to the more immediate book-by-book arcs, to character growth arcs as well the powers hes slowly gaining, to the specific setup, lore and principles by which the world they live in opporates. This is an author you can trust to give you good pay offs and not waste your time with filler.

one small critique. The way things happened around the end was a bit unexpected for me. Because of the way he was saved from his circumstance, it almost felt like the MC was robbed of the opportunity to avenge himself and proove himself different from the views some of the antagonists in particular held toward Tyron Steelarm. That said, this isn't necessarily bad, I think if the MC acknowledges this in the next book and vocalizes a desire to not find himself in the same situation again, then it could proove to be a key factor for motivating him (along with all the other potent motivating factors we see in this book)


I highly recommend the credit for this book. You will be satistied, the author did such a good job with both books 1 & 2 of this series that I'm at the point were I trust in this author like I do Will Wight (aka: Author of the Cradle Series)

As for the Narrator: All his voices are distinct, consistent, and well executed, offering smooth emersion that will have you sinking into the world and characters of this book in no time.

To the Author and Narrator, Thank you.
